Conjugation
of
usay
Translation
Ñuqa
Qam
Pay
Ñuqanchik
Ñuqayku
Qamkuna
Paykuna
Present tense
usani
I am able to
usanki
you are able to
usan
he/she/it is able to
usanchik
we (with you) are able to
usayku
we (without you) are able to
usankichik
you all are able to
usanku
they are able to
Future tense
usasaq
I will be able to
usanki
you will be able to
usanqa
he/she/it will be able to
usasunchik
we (with you) will be able to
usasaqku
we (without you) will be able to
usankichik
you all will be able to
usanqaku
they will be able to
Past experienced tense
usarqani
I was able to
usarqanki
you were able to
usarqan
he/she/it was able to
usarqanchik
we (with you) were able to
usarqaniku
we (without you) were able to
usarqankichik
you all were able to
usarqanku
they were able to
Past reported tense
usasqani
I (reportedly) was able to
usasqanki
you (reportedly) were able to
usasqan
he/she/it (reportedly) was able to
usasqanchik
we (with you) (reportedly) were able to
usasqaniku
we (without you) (reportedly) were able to
usasqankichik
you all (reportedly) were able to
usasqanku
they (reportedly) were able to
